>> On 9/3/25 12:26, Ben Bolker wrote:
>>>
>>> I don't see it in the queue:
>>>
>>>   > foghorn::winbuilder_queue() |> subset(package=="Ecdat")
>>>
>>> # A tibble: 0 × 5
>> <https://www.google.com/maps/search/le:+0+%C3%97+5?entry=gmail&source=g>
>>> # ℹ 5 variables: package <chr>, version <pckg_vrs>, folder <chr>, time
>>> <dttm>,
>>> #   size <int>
>>>
>>> but IIRC this only shows packages that are actually in the queue, not
>>> those being processed ...
